Abstract:
Although Florida law requires all motorcyclists to wear helmets, 16 percent of all motorcycle drivers and 30 percent of all their passengers killed in motorcycle crashes in 1996 were not wearing protective helmets. In addition, the use of novelty helmets may be on the rise in states with universal helmet laws. The objectives of this research were to determine motorcycle helmet use rates on Florida roadways and to estimate the level of novelty helmet use by motorcycle occupants. Abstract:
In this work, safety of motorcycle helmet design is investigated by using standard oblique impact test method. First, testing procedure is explained and test rig mechanism is introduced. Next, standard impact tests are performed on helmets. Data are collected using a tri-axial linear accelerometer embedded inside the headform and a high speed camera for measuring rotational acceleration. Then, results are studied and compared to injurious limit for human head injury.
